af_compand: make sure request_frame always outputs at least one frame

This fixes a segmentation fault because request_frame in fifo.c assumes
that the call to ff_request_frame will populate fifo->root.next.
Before, it was possible for request_frame in af_compand to not do this,
resulting in a null pointer access. Now, request_frame in af_compand
always will return at least one frame or an error, as per the API
specifications in avfilter.h for request_frame.
